I noticed that sometimes, but not always, only 3 of 4 GPUGRID tasks show up in the BOINC Tasks Tasks tab on Ver. 1.09, but BOING Manager (Ver. 6.10.58) always shows the correct number. Restarting BOINC Tasks does not clear the problem. When the symptom occurs, the BOINC Tasks Message tab shows the "reached the limit of 4 GPU tasks" message for the GPUGRID data request, but only 3 GPUGRID tasks are shown on the Tasks tab. I get it now.
The 3rd GPUGRID entry in the Tasks tab says "2[Tasks]", rather than showing each task on its own line, as BOINC Manager does.
So I guess my request would be to show each task on its own line all the time, just to make the user interface a bit more straight forward.

Right-click the task, go through "Filter (combin) tasks according to" and play around with the checkboxes...
Thanks! That did it.
